BEACHBUB All-In-One Beach Umbrella System
Higher ratedRanked #1 in Best Beach Umbrellas
BEACHBUB All-In-One Beach Umbrella System
$165

The beachBUB All-In-One is the only beach umbrella on the market certified to ASTM F3681-24 compliance, and it earns it: the patented ULTRA Base holds up to 125 lbs of sand and was independently wind-tested to 44 mph. The trade-off is a 15-minute setup ritual and no tilt mechanism. If you've ever chased a runaway umbrella down the beach, the security premium is worth every extra minute.

Strengths
  • ASTM F3681-24 compliant — exceeds the new federal beach-umbrella safety standard by 160% when the ULTRA Base is properly filled
  • Independently wind-tested up to 44.4 mph with the 125-lb sand-filled ULTRA Base anchor
  • Commercial-grade 1.5mm two-piece aluminum pole with six 10mm fiberglass ribs tested at 400+ lbs pulling force
Watch-outs
  • No tilt feature — you reposition your chair as the sun moves
  • 15-20 minute setup involves filling the sand base and screwing the pole assembly
  • 9 lbs packed weight is heavy for long beach walks
Tommy Bahama Sand Anchor 7-Foot Beach Umbrella with Tilt
Ranked #3 in Best Beach Umbrellas
Tommy Bahama Sand Anchor 7-Foot Beach Umbrella with Tilt
$67

The Tommy Bahama Sand Anchor 7-foot is the classic beach umbrella refined to a point: built-in auger, two-way tilt, UPF 50+ canopy, telescoping aluminum pole — under $70 in most colorways. The hardware is solid for the price and the integrated anchor outperforms most umbrellas in this tier. The trade-off is honesty about wind: there's no ASTM certification and it will roll over above 20-25 mph, so think of it as a calm-day workhorse rather than a stormy-coast tool.

Strengths
  • Built-in sand auger drives 9-10 inches deep — among the deepest integrated anchors in this price range
  • Two-way adjustable tilt up to 30 degrees lets you track the sun without moving your chair
  • UPF 50+ silver-lined canopy with top wind vent for stability in moderate breezes
Watch-outs
  • Not ASTM F3681-24 certified — wind-resistance claims are marketing, not third-party tested
  • Plastic handle and tilt-lock components feel flimsy compared to the metal hardware on the BEACHBUB
  • Field reports of canopy inversion in 25+ mph gusts — handle this as a calm-to-moderate beach umbrella

How they stack up

BEACHBUB All-In-One Beach Umbrella System

The BEACHBUB is the only umbrella in this lineup with verified ASTM compliance — the Tommy Bahama Sand Anchor markets wind resistance but lacks the certification, and the AMMSUN's plastic auger doesn't meet the resistance threshold the standard requires. The Sport-Brella Premiere XL gets there with side panels and tethers but tops out around twenty mph in real testing. The Pacific Breeze Easy Setup is a different category entirely — a pop-up shelter, not a wind-anchored umbrella.

Tommy Bahama Sand Anchor 7-Foot Beach Umbrella with Tilt

The Tommy Bahama Sand Anchor is the budget-tilt option in this lineup — the Sport-Brella Premiere XL also tilts but costs $25 more and uses a stake-and-tether system; the AMMSUN 7.5ft tilts and undercuts the Tommy Bahama by $15 but has a less premium feel. Against the BEACHBUB All-In-One, the Tommy Bahama is a totally different value proposition: half the price, two-minute setup, but no ASTM certification and a fraction of the wind rating. The Pacific Breeze Easy Setup is in a separate category entirely as a pop-up shelter.
